reserved
test pin; connected to digital ground for normal operation
test pin; connected to digital ground for normal operation
line-locked clock; this is the 27 MHz master clock for the encoder
digital ground 1
digital supply voltage 1
raster control 1 for video port; this pin receives/provides a VS/FS/FSEQ signal
raster control 2 for video port; this pin provides an HS pulse of programmable length or
receives an HS pulse
MPEG port; it is an input for “CCIR 656” style multiplexed Cb Y, Cr data
digital supply voltage 2
digital ground 2
Real Time Control input; if the LLC clock is provided by an SAA7111 or SAA7151B,
RTCI should be connected to pin RTCO of the decoder to improve the signal quality
reserved
the I
reserved
reserved
analog output of the chrominance signal
analog supply voltage 1 for the C DAC
reserved
analog output of VBS signal
analog supply voltage 2 for the Y DAC
reserved
analog output of the CVBS signal
analog supply voltage 3 for the CVBS DAC
analog ground 1 for the DACs
analog ground 2 for the oscillator and reference voltage
crystal oscillator output (to crystal)
crystal oscillator input (from crystal); if the oscillator is not used, this pin should be
connected to ground
analog supply voltage 4 for the oscillator and reference voltage
clock output of the crystal oscillator
2
C-bus slave address select input pin; LOW: slave address = 88H, HIGH = 8CH
